Austin REALTORSĀ® Leverages Multiple REALTORĀ® Party Grants in Support of Missing Middle Housing

With strong support from Austin REALTORSĀ®, in 2023, the City of Austin approved the Home Options for Middle-income Empowerment (HOME) Resolution, initiating code amendments to reduce the minimum lot size to 2,500 square feet or less and allow for up to three residential dwelling units per lot. Backed by a variety of REALTORĀ® Party resources, the REALTORSĀ® are maintaining the momentum toward increasing ā€˜missing middleā€™ housing.

Charlottesville Area Association of REALTORSĀ® Supports New Zoning Ordinance Aimed at Correcting Racial Inequity and Increasing Inventory of Affordable Housing

When a racist rally occurred in Charlottesville, Virginia in August 2017, it prompted the City Council to focus on municipal policies through a lens of racial inequity. City leaders revisited the comprehensive land use plan with an eye toward improving affordable housing, an area that had always been intimately linked with race. The Charlottesville Area Association of REALTORSĀ® endorsed the major zoning reform and used grants from the REALTORĀ® Party to support its passage.

NAR Thanks President Biden for Addressing Housing Supply in State of the Union

On Thursday night, President Joe Biden announced a number of housing initiatives in the State of the Union address (SOTU), calling for a $10,000 tax credit for both first-time homebuyers and people who sell their starter homes; the construction and renovation of more than 2 million additional homes, lower closing costs and cost reductions for renters.

Illinois REALTORSĀ® and the Chicago Association of REALTORSĀ® Conduct Campaign to Defeat Transfer Tax Referendum

With help from an Issues Mobilization Grant from the REALTORĀ® Party, Illinois REALTORSĀ® and the Chicago Association of REALTORSĀ® fought a misguided referendum seeking to use an increase in real estate transfer taxes to fight homelessness. Understanding that the proposal would be detrimental to the local economy, the REALTORSĀ® launched an energetic effort to persuade voters to oppose it at the ballot box.

Utah Association of REALTORSĀ® Conducts Compelling Social Media Campaign in Support of Major Legislation Boosting New Housing

For five years, the Utah Association of REALTORSĀ® has been working with the governorā€™s office and the state legislature to engineer solutions to the stateā€™s dire shortage of affordable housing. The recent session saw the creation of some game-changing approaches to funding, among other advances and reforms, which the state REALTORSĀ® supported with their first big social media buy. An Issues Mobilization Grant helped make it possible.
